A mere Hawaii today (5.0 O's) - a day of intermittent cloud. Hopefully this month will offset the dire production earlier in the year.
I appear to have addressed the inverter getting too hot by adding a 15W fan and thermostatically controlled plug. Sat and Sun are forecast to be warmer, so we'll see.
It's hard to find concrete information regarding Growatt derating, but it seems that it's a linear derating from 45c, with a 65c shut down.
